Description

I thought the 2015 vintage of this wine was an outstanding wine, a “Wow wine”, but this Pegasus Bay Bel Canto Riesling 2017 is just as impressive. It’s a remarkable wine that perfectly captures the characteristics of the 2017 vintage in the North Canterbury region of New Zealand. Warm days and cool nights that help balance the ripeness of the grapes with the refreshing acidity are the norm for these vineyards but in 2017 following the warm summer months, there were perfect conditions for the development of noble botrytis, which is essential for this wine’s structure, richness and full body. Cool fermentation ensured the fruit purity was retained. On the nose, this wine presents strong citrus aromas of ripe lime and orange zest with floral notes of orange blossom shining through. On the palate, the wine is dry, crisp and refreshing, with well-balanced acidity that accentuates the fruit flavours. The palate is dominated by citrus flavours of lime and grapefruit, with hints of apricot and ginger. The texture of the wine is silky and luxurious, and the finish is lingering and dry. A really beautiful Riesling that will continue to evolve gracefully with age.

 

Raymond Chan who sadly passed away described Riesling as one of the two “signature varieties of the Waipara Valley in North Canterbury” and Pegasus Bay as “leaders” in its production. Often in wine-making the aim is to express the terroir of a single vineyard but not with this wine because according to the winemaker at Pegasus Bay, Mat Donaldson, although single sites in the region do show an individual character and terroir, not all of them are worthy of capturing and expressing. Raymond Chan describes the style of this wine as “particularly connected with the tastes of the sophisticated consumer”.

How to enjoy this wine

Chilled this makes an amazing aperitif. Foods that dry Rieslings are well suited to include shellfish, fish generally but especially smoked fish and oily fish. Rich creamy dishes. Mild dishes – don’t try anything too hot or chilli-flavoured with a dry Riesling as the heat will kill the beautiful fruit flavours of the wine. Asparagus and artichokes can both be very tricky to pair with wine but are perfect with a dry Riesling.

 

Serve at: 10 – 12°C

Producer's Notes

“The colour is lemon-straw. On the nose there is an abundance of citrus, in particular the orange zest that is such a regional feature of North Canterbury Rieslings. There are also aromas of apricot, ginger and spice. The long hang time and influence of botrytis has resulted in a wine that is rich and full bodied, with ripe phenolics that add structure and length. It is mouth filling, yet balanced with refreshing acidity and a dry finish.”
